Abu Dhabi Mainland Licensing Authority
The Abu Dhabi Business Centre, a division of ADDED, provides economic licensing services to investors and businesses. ADDED explains that licensing services fall under two broad categories: Economic Licenses and Permits. Economic licenses allow businesses to practise specific economic activities after fulfilling the conditions required under applicable laws, while permits may be used for things such as advertisements, accessories, temporary activities, or assigned activities.
ADDED also states that investors can apply for licenses and permits through TAMM eServices.
This digital structure makes the process more streamlined, but the correct activity, legal form, tenancy, and external approvals still need to be selected carefully.

Abu Dhabi Mainland License Types
Abu Dhabi offers several types of economic licenses depending on the business model, activity, and investor profile. ADDED lists the following types of economic licenses:
Standard License
This is the standard economic license that permits a business to operate in Abu Dhabi. ADDED states that the standard license accommodates all legal forms and follows traditional business establishment procedures.
Abu Dhabi Trader License
The Abu Dhabi Trader License is issued electronically for specific commercial activities and is available to UAE citizens and residents.
Dual License
The Dual License allows establishments registered in Abu Dhabi free zones to carry out their activities and manage business outside the free zone area.
Freelancer License
The Freelancer License is available to citizens and foreigners for specific economic activities in certain fields and allows remote activity without requiring physical office premises.
Virtual License
The Virtual License is an economic license for individuals residing outside the UAE who wish to start a business in Abu Dhabi.
Mobdea License
The Mobdea License is available to UAE national women for selected activities, largely focused on creative work, and does not require a physical headquarters.
Small Producers License
The Small Producers License is issued to citizens who own private farms and provide agricultural and animal husbandry services in specific areas.
For most foreign investors establishing a standard mainland company, the Standard License is usually the relevant route, but the final recommendation depends on the business activity and investor profile.

Abu Dhabi Mainland Office and Location Requirements
For many Abu Dhabi mainland companies, having a suitable business location and tenancy contract is an important part of the setup process. ADDED explains that investors must find a suitable business location and obtain a tenancy contract as part of the business setup process.
The type of premises depends on the activity. A restaurant needs an approved food premises. A clinic requires healthcare-compliant premises. A shop requires a retail location. A contracting or technical services company may need an office or approved facility. An industrial business may need a warehouse, workshop, or industrial space.
ADDED also notes that choosing the right office space and location is vital to business operations, and investors should ensure the premises comply with business requirements in Abu Dhabi.
Some license categories may allow online or remote operations. ADDED states that if a business does not need physical premises, investors can obtain a license to operate online through TAMM.

Corporate Tax and Bookkeeping for Abu Dhabi Mainland Companies
Abu Dhabi mainland companies should maintain proper accounting records and comply with UAE Corporate Tax requirements where applicable. The UAE Ministry of Finance states that Corporate Tax is imposed on taxable income earned by a taxable person in a tax period, and taxable income is generally calculated from accounting net profit after required adjustments.
The Ministry of Finance also states that taxable persons are required to register for Corporate Tax and file a Corporate Tax return within nine months from the end of the relevant tax period.
